返回   MATLAB中国论坛|MATLAB爱好者之家—不仅仅是MATLAB! > 特色讨论区:工程数学软件-不仅仅是MATLAB! > MATLAB论坛 > MATLAB算法讨论


挖掘已有资源,发帖前请先搜索!
虚拟主机 域名注册 香港空间
回复
 
LinkBack 主题工具 显示模式
旧 2011-12-06, 12:06 PM   #1
初级会员
 
注册日期: 2011-11-11
帖子: 1
感谢他人: 0
有 0 帖获得 0 感谢
声望力: 0
supercaosong 正向着好的方向发展
默认 BP的一道题

建立一个3层前向网络,其中输入层两个神经元(与输入变量个数一致),隐含层两个神经元,输出层一个神经元。实现异或门(XOR)。
XOR的真值表,也即是训练样本:
网络结构:
其中x0=1,y0=1 ,w110 、w120 、w210 为阈值,其他 为权值。
激活函数用sigmoid函数:f(x)=1/(1+e-x)
(1)在MATLAB中,针对以上XOR网络建模问题,编写一个BP算法程序,确定网络模型的权值和阈值。
(2)确定权值与阈值后,写出XOR的网络模型,即输入自变量,则可通过XOR的网络模型,获得因变量预测值。
(3)程序源代码(一个训练程序,一个预测程序)
(4)给出模型的预测结果
(5)对XOR网络建模问题进行分析
上传的图像
文件类型: jpg QQ截图20111206114942.jpg (14.5 KB, 3 次查看)
文件类型: jpg QQ截图20111206114959.jpg (11.4 KB, 3 次查看)
supercaosong 当前离线   回复时引用此帖
回复

书签

主题工具
显示模式

发帖规则
不可以发表新主题
可以发表回复
不可以上传附件
不可以编辑自己的帖子

启用 BB 代码
论坛启用 表情符号
论坛启用 [IMG] 代码
论坛禁用 HTML 代码
Trackbacks are 禁用
Pingbacks are 禁用
Refbacks are 启用



所有时间均为北京时间。现在的时间是 01:10 AM


Powered by vBulletin
版权所有 ©2000 - 2012,Jelsoft Enterprises Ltd.
陕ICP备07001583号
感谢MEyu科技提供优质空间

SEO by vBSEO ©2009, Crawlability, Inc.